inv_pos
∀ {G₀ : Type u_3} [inst : GroupWithZero G₀] [inst_1 : PartialOrder G₀] [PosMulReflectLT G₀] {a : G₀}, 0 < a⁻¹ ↔ 0 < a- Cited by
